Voxtet
|
Voxtet is an essentially jazz based close harmony vocal group with eight singers accompanied by a jazz quintet featuring a four piece rhythm section and saxophonist. All the vocalists/musicians are London based working in west end shows, orchestras, big bands, sessions and jazz ensembles. Several have released their own albums The vocal group is: Donna Canale, Yona Dunsford, Jacqui Hicks, Alison Jiear, Emer McParland, and Sam Shaw, with Andrew Playfoot and Colin Skinner. The rhythm section is: Pete Callard (guitar), Nick Moss (sax), Dave Jones (bass) and the King of Groove, Frosty Beedle, on drums "With their state-of-the-art vocal harmony, all-embracing repertoire and joy in true music-making. Clive Dunstall's Voxtet expands the traditions of Manhattan Transfer, New York Voices and Take Six with skills that would have their inspirations shouting for joy...They are simply the best vocal group in Britain. Concert promoters, jazz entrepreneurs or just those who love the job done properly - miss them at your own risk!" Digby Fairweather

Jeremy Allen
|
Jeremy Allen trained and worked as an actor for 5 years before turning his hand to music and writing. As well as gigging around the London circuit, he has written and performed 'The Scarecrow' - a modern, musical fairytale - at the Emery Theatre in Poplar and at The Heathcote Arms. Jeremy has also toured a one-man children's show- 'Tales of Brer Rabbit'- around Arts Centres in the South-East and in 1999 won a Melody Maker sponsored lyric writing competition for a song called 'The Magnificent Evans' He has gigged regularly at venues such as the 12-Bar Club, Acoustic Café, Mean Fiddler, Dublin Castle and The Spot in Covent Garden. Festivals have included Cambridge, Oxford, Fleadh and Harlow

Sarah Fisher
|
Sarah has been a professional musician for 20 years. She toured with pop band The Eurythmics (Annie Lennox), works as a session keyboard player with various artists and has appeared on TV programs including Top of the Pops. She performs regularly as a singer-pianist in London and has played throughout the UK and abroad. Her song repertoire is extensive and covers all genres of music from jazz to contemporary pop. She also has her own band 'Sax in the City' Sarah is available for all functions including weddings, private parties and corporate events |
